AESUB: A sublimation spray for 3D scanning that naturally disappears.

This is a spray for scanning works with transparent, black, and glossy surfaces. After use, it sublimates naturally, so no post-processing is required. *Demonstration available.

AESUB is a sublimation spray for 3D scanning. It eliminates the need for removal work, thereby reducing post-processing steps. [Features] ■ No post-processing required, hassle-free AESUB naturally sublimates over time after application. Unlike typical powder sprays, it does not require wiping or cleaning, thus reducing effort. ■ Scan effortlessly by applying target markers after spraying Since AESUB forms a film-like layer rather than a powder, you can apply markers on top of the spray. This allows for smooth scanning operations. ■ A wide range of options to choose from based on work size and environment There are a total of six types, each with distinct characteristics. You can choose from blue for small work, orange for medium to large work with long-lasting effects, green for extra-large work with spray gun refill type, yellow for precision work, transparent for color scanning, and white for non-sublimating type, all tailored to your usage environment. *Please feel free to contact us if you would like TDS and SDS.

[Document Overview] With the advent of low-cost and easy-to-introduce 3D scanners, it has become easier to utilize 3D scan data. However, to scan workpieces that have characteristics such as black color or gloss, which are challenging for 3D scanners, it is necessary to use powder spray, which can lead to several inconveniences: - Fine powder can get into gaps. - Careful handling is required to avoid scratching the workpiece. - Since it cannot be washed, it must be wiped off.
